概述
最近部分用户反馈 TPWallet 最新版本在发起或加速交易时出现“卡死”或长时间挂起的问题。表现形态包括:交易提交后在钱包界面长时间显示“pending”,交易未被打包,无法通过界面取消或替换(replace),或者界面卡顿导致用户重复提交相同 nonce 的交易,进而造成链上交易冲突与失败。
可能成因(技术面)
1) 客户端状态管理异常:前端对交易池本地状态、nonce 或 gasPrice 估计逻辑处理不当,导致重复提交或界面不刷新。
2) 节点/中继层问题:RPC 节点响应超时、mempool 同步延迟或中继服务短时故障,使交易未能被推送到区块链网络。
3) 交易替换(Replace)逻辑缺失:未能正确实现 EIP-1559 或 legacy 交易的替换/加速流程。
4) 后端限流与队列拥堵:服务端对于高并发请求的处理能力不足,导致请求排队、超时或丢失。
5) 用户端网络与签名超时:移动端网络波动或签名服务(如硬件钱包、中间件)阻塞。
安全响应与事件处置建议
- 快速隔离影响范围:通过日志、监控和用户上报定位受影响版本、平台与时间窗,尽快下线或回滚有问题的发布。
- 提供临时手动指南:向用户说明临时替代方案(如使用其他 RPC 节点、等待链上确认、手动替换 nonce 的方法)并在官网/社群发布风险提示。
- 增设回退机制:客户端应提供“撤销/恢复默认 RPC”“切换节点”“强制重新广播”等操作入口。

- 取证与审计:保留交易日志、签名证明与 RPC 请求记录,便于事后追溯与合规审计。
前瞻性技术路径
- 可插拔 RPC 层:实现多节点负载均衡与健康检查,自动切换健康节点以避免单点故障。
- 智能交易池(client-side mempool):本地维护交易队列和 nonce 管理策略,支持事务替换/加速逻辑自动化。
- Layer 2/聚合器优先:在钱包中原生支持 Layer2 路由与聚合交易,降低主网拥堵影响。
- 可视化回滚与重放:设计可追溯的交易状态机,允许用户安全重放或回滚未确认交易。
专家评析(关键利弊)
- 利:增强的 RPC 路由与本地交易池能显著减少“卡死”概率,并改善用户体验。支持替换/加速逻辑能及时解决 nonce 冲突。
- 弊:增加复杂性,可能引入新的同步问题或安全漏洞;多节点策略需要有效的信任与防篡改机制来避免中间人攻击。
智能化数据分析与监控

- 指标体系:监控 TX 提交延迟、RPC 响应时延、pending 交易比例、nonce 冲突率、重复提交率等核心指标。
- 异常检测:利用时序模型或轻量级 ML 检测突发性 pending 激增并自动触发告警与限流策略。
- 根因分析平台:结合链上可视化、节点日志与用户行为链路,自动输出可能的根因候选并给出修复建议。
可扩展性存储与数据管理
- 本地轻量化缓存:对用户交易元数据做短期缓存与加密存储,减少重复签名请求。
- 链下归档与分层存储:将历史交易和诊断日志分层存储,冷数据可移至对象存储或去中心化存储(如 IPFS、Arweave)以降低成本。
- 存储伸缩策略:结合分区、压缩与按需加载设计,保证在高并发排查时仍能快速查询。
代币市值与生态影响评估
- 直接影响:用户体验问题会短期降低用户信任,造成代币流动性下降或抛售压力,但影响程度取决于问题持续时间和官方响应速度。
- 间接影响:若卡死问题与签名或私钥处理有关,可能触发安全恐慌,导致更广泛的市场波动。
- 修复与恢复信心:及时透明的沟通、补偿机制(如 gas 补偿、空投)与技术改进可快速修复市场信心,代币市值往往在恢复期内回稳。
建议与路线图(短中长期)
短期:紧急补丁、提供临时手动替换文档、增加多 RPC 节点切换、社群透明沟通。
中期:重构本地交易池与替换逻辑,完善监控与告警,做节点冗余与负载均衡。
长期:支持 Layer2 原生路由、引入 ML 驱动的异常检测与预测、采用分层冷热存储与去中心化归档。
结语
TPWallet 交易卡死问题既有工程实现层面的短期修复路径,也需要长期在架构、智能监控与生态策略上投入。透明的安全响应、可观测性建设与面向可扩展性的技术路线,是恢复用户信心与保护代币市值的关键。
评论
Crypto小白
解释得很清楚,希望官方能尽快推出补丁并公布技术细节。
AnnaWu
多 RPC 切换和本地交易池听起来靠谱,期待实装。
链上观察者
监控与异步告警很重要,建议增加用户端的错误上报入口。
Tech老王
文章平衡了短期应对和长期架构,很实用。